Research Interests
Affective computing, ubiquitous sensing, and human-computer interaction. The research focuses on the diagnosis, treatment and human-computer interaction of affective disorders based on multimodal behaviors such as facial expressions, eye movements and network behaviors.

Additional Information
Focusing on the research of diagnosis and treatment of affective disorders based on ubiquitous sensor data, in the past five years, he has published more than 20 papers as first author or corresponding author in high-level journals and conferences such as Proceedings of the IEEE (PIEEE), IEEE Transactions on Knowledge and Data Engineering (TKDE), IEEE Transactions on Circuits and Systems for Video Technology (TCSVT), IEEE Journal of Biomedical and Health Informatics (JBHI), IEEE Wireless Communications Magazine (WCM), IEEE Internet of Things Journal (IOTJ), IEEE Transactions on Neural Systems and Rehabilitation Engineering (TNSRE), IEEE Transactions on Computational Social Systems (TCSS), IEEE Transactions on Cybernetics and Social Computing (TCDS) and IEEE International Conference on Bioinformatics and Biomedicine (BIBM). Many papers have been selected as ESI Highly Cited Papers, with the total impact factor exceeding 150. He has obtained 8 authorized national invention patents, and more than 20 utility model patents and software copyrights. He has also won awards such as ACM Outstanding Doctoral Dissertation Award, MobiHealth 2021 Best Paper Award, IEEE 2020 Outstanding Service Award, Second Prize for Teaching Achievements of Lanzhou University, and multiple Excellent Instructor Awards in national professional competitions.
In the past five years, through guiding students to participate in scientific research projects and research training, he has helped undergraduate students publish 7 SCI papers, 2 papers in CCF-recommended journals/conferences, and obtain 4 authorized invention patents.
